What must candidates determine regarding power requirements?

Candidates must determine the nature of loads, voltage, frequency, and amperage because these factors are critical in ensuring that the power distribution system operates effectively and safely. Understanding the nature of the loads helps to identify whether they are resistive, inductive, or capacitive, which will affect how power is supplied. Voltage and frequency are essential for compatibility with equipment and to ensure it operates as expected. Amperage is necessary to calculate the overall current demand and to size conductors and protective devices properly. Gathering this information allows for appropriate system design and helps prevent overloads and potential hazards.

While the type of cables and connectors can be important for establishing a reliable electrical connection and the age of the system might indicate its condition, these considerations stem from the primary need to understand the electrical requirements effectively. Distance from the power source to the load is also relevant, as it can impact voltage drop and overall efficiency, but it is a secondary consideration once the basic power requirements are established.
